Chairperson, I move without notice:
That the Council -
(1) notes the recent outbreak of foot-and-mouth disease in the district of Camperdown in KwaZulu-Natal; (2) acknowledges the serious economic consequences of this disease for the South African economy and, in particular, for the farming community of KwaZulu-Natal and certain areas of Mpumalanga;
(3) further acknowledges efforts by the Department of Agriculture to combat this dreadful disease, involving the putting down of thousands of animals; and
(4) calls on the Government quickly to take the necessary steps to compensate the affected farmers for the loss of livestock and the suspension of farming activities.
Motion agreed to in accordance with section 65 of the Constitution.
